Corner Tables
Corner tables for laboratories are specialized furniture designed to optimize the utilization of space within laboratory settings. These tables are shaped to fit into corners, making efficient use of the available room while providing a functional and safe workspace for various laboratory tasks. Here are some key features and considerations for corner tables in laboratories:
- Space Optimization:
- Corner tables are specifically designed to fit into corners, allowing laboratories to make the most of their available space.
- Shape and Design:
- These tables typically have an L-shaped or triangular design to snugly fit into the corner of a room. The shape may vary based on the specific needs of the laboratory.
- Material:
- They are constructed from materials suitable for laboratory environments, such as stainless steel, chemical-resistant laminates, or other materials that can withstand exposure to chemicals and rigorous cleaning.
- Durability:
- Corner tables are built to be durable and able to withstand the demands of a laboratory setting, where equipment and materials may be heavy or subject to spills.
- Work Surface:
- The tabletop provides a flat, stable work surface for conducting experiments, preparing samples, or performing various laboratory tasks.
- Storage Options:
- Some corner tables come with integrated storage solutions, such as shelves or drawers, to help organize and store laboratory equipment, chemicals, or supplies.
- Mobility:
- Depending on the design, some corner tables may have wheels or casters for easy mobility, allowing flexibility in the laboratory layout.
- Adjustability:
- Certain models may be adjustable in height to accommodate different users or experimental setups.
- Electrical Outlets:
- Some corner tables may come with built-in electrical outlets or other services to power laboratory equipment.
- Chemical Resistance:
- The materials used in construction are chosen for their resistance to a wide range of chemicals commonly used in laboratories.
- Compliance:
- Corner tables may be designed to meet certain industry or safety standards, complying with regulations for laboratory furniture.
By incorporating corner tables into laboratory layouts, researchers and technicians can efficiently use available space, promoting better organization and workflow in the laboratory environment.
